SELF-DIAGNOSIS CANNOT BE PERFORMED

Self-Diagnosis

INFOID:0000000001682699

SYMPTOM: Self-diagnosis cannot be performed.

INSPECTION FLOW

1.

CONFIRM SYMPTOM BY PERFORMING OPERATIONAL CHECK - AUTO MODE

1.

Press the AUTO switch.

2.

Display should indicate AUTO. Discharge air and blower speed will depend on ambient, in-vehicle and set
temperatures.

Can a symptom be duplicated?

YES

>> GO TO 2.

NO

>> Perform a complete operational check. Refer to 

XX-XX, "*****"

.

2.

CHECK FOR SERVICE BULLETINS

Check for any service bulletins.

>> GO TO 3.

3.

CHECK POWER SUPPLY AND GROUND CIRCUIT

Check the power supply and ground circuit. Refer to 

XX-XX, "*****"

.

Is the inspection result normal?

YES

>> Cause cannot be confirmed by self-diagnosis.

NO

>> GO TO 4.

4.

CHECK AMBIENT SENSOR CIRCUIT

Check ambient sensor circuit. Refer to 

XX-XX, "*****"

.

Is the inspection result normal?

YES

>> GO TO 5.

NO

>> Repair or replace as necessary.

5.

CHECK IN-VEHICLE SENSOR CIRCUIT

Check in-vehicle sensor circuit. Refer to 

XX-XX, "*****"

.

Is the inspection result normal?

YES

>> GO TO 6.

NO

>> Repair or replace as necessary.

6.

CHECK INTAKE SENSOR CIRCUIT

Check intake sensor circuit. Refer to 

XX-XX, "*****"

.

Is the inspection result normal?

YES

>> GO TO 7.

NO

>> Repair or replace as necessary.

7.

CHECK AIR MIX DOOR MOTOR PBR CIRCUIT

Check air mix door motor PBR circuit. Refer to 

XX-XX, "*****"

.

Is the inspection result normal?

OK

>> Perform a complete operational check and check for other symptoms. Refer to 

XX-XX, "*****"

.

NG

>> Repair or replace as necessary.

MEMORY FUNCTION DOES NOT OPERATE

MEMORY FUNCTION DOES NOT OPERATE

Memory Function Check

INFOID:0000000001547459

SYMPTOM: Memory function does not operate.

INSPECTION FLOW

1.

CONFIRM SYMPTOM BY PERFORMING OPERATIONAL CHECK - MEMORY FUNCTION

1.

Set the temperature to 32

°

C (90

°

F).

2.

Rotate the front blower control dial (driver) to turn system OFF.

3.

Turn ignition switch OFF.

4.

Turn ignition switch ON.

5.

Press the AUTO switch.

6.

Confirm that the set temperature remains at previous temperature.

7.

Rotate the front blower control dial (LH) to turn system OFF.

Can the symptom be duplicated?

YES

>> GO TO 3.

NO

>> GO TO 2.

2.

PERFORM COMPLETE OPERATIONAL CHECK

Perform a complete operational check and check for any symptoms. Refer to 

HAC-87, "Operational Check"

Can a symptom be duplicated?

YES

>> Refer to 

HAC-86, "How to Perform Trouble Diagnosis For Quick And Accurate Repair"

.

NO

>> System OK.

3.

CHECK FOR SERVICE BULLETINS

Check for any service bulletins.

>> GO TO 4.

4.

PERFORM SELF-DIAGNOSIS

Perform self-diagnosis to check for any codes. Refer to 

HAC-98, "Front Air Control Self-Diagnosis"

.

Are any self-diagnosis codes present?

YES

>> Refer to 

HAC-104, "A/C System Self-Diagnosis Code Chart"

.

NO

>> GO TO 5.

5.

CHECK POWER AND GROUND CIRCUIT

Check main power supply and ground circuit. Refer to 

HAC-163, "Front Air Control Component Function

Check"

.

Is the inspection result normal?

YES

>> GO TO 6.

NO

>> Repair or replace as necessary.

6.

RECHECK FOR SYMPTOMS 

Perform a complete operational check for any symptoms. Refer to 

HAC-87, "Operational Check"

.

Does another symptom exist?

YES

>> Refer to 

HAC-86, "How to Perform Trouble Diagnosis For Quick And Accurate Repair"

NO

>> Replace A/C Auto amp. Refer to 

XX-XX, "*****"

.

PRECAUTION

PRECAUTIONS

Precaution for Supplemental Restraint System (SRS) "AIR BAG" and "SEAT BELT 
PRE-TENSIONER"

INFOID:0000000001548138

The Supplemental Restraint System such as “AIR BAG” and “SEAT BELT PRE-TENSIONER”, used along
with a front seat belt, helps to reduce the risk or severity of injury to the driver and front passenger for certain
types of collision. Information necessary to service the system safely is included in the SRS and SB section of
this Service Manual.

WARNING:

• To avoid rendering the SRS inoperative, which could increase the risk of personal injury or death in

the event of a collision which would result in air bag inflation, all maintenance must be performed by
an authorized NISSAN/INFINITI dealer.

• Improper maintenance, including incorrect removal and installation of the SRS, can lead to personal

injury caused by unintentional activation of the system. For removal of Spiral Cable and Air Bag
Module, see the SRS section.

• Do not use electrical test equipment on any circuit related to the SRS unless instructed to in this

Service Manual. SRS wiring harnesses can be identified by yellow and/or orange harnesses or har-
ness connectors.

Working with HFC-134a (R-134a)

INFOID:0000000001547461

WARNING:

• CFC-12 (R-12) refrigerant and HFC-134a (R-134a) refrigerant are not compatible. If the refrigerants

are mixed compressor failure is likely to occur. Refer to 

XX-XX, "*****"

. To determine the purity of

HFC-134a (R-134a) in the vehicle and recovery tank, use Refrigerant Recovery/Recycling Recharging
equipment and Refrigerant Identifier.

• Use only specified oil for the HFC-134a (R-134a) A/C system and HFC-134a (R-134a) components. If

oil other than that specified is used, compressor failure is likely to occur.

• The specified HFC-134a (R-134a) oil rapidly absorbs moisture from the atmosphere. The following

handling precautions must be observed:

- When removing refrigerant components from a vehicle, immediately cap (seal) the component to

minimize the entry of moisture from the atmosphere.

- When installing refrigerant components to a vehicle, do not remove the caps (unseal) until just

before connecting the components. Connect all refrigerant loop components as quickly as possible
to minimize the entry of moisture into system.

- Only use the specified oil from a sealed container. Immediately reseal containers of oil. Without

proper sealing, oil will become moisture saturated and should not be used.

- Avoid breathing A/C refrigerant and oil vapor or mist. Exposure may irritate eyes, nose and throat.

Remove HFC-134a (R-134a) from the A/C system using certified service equipment meeting require-
ments of SAE J2210 [HFC-134a (R-134a) recycling equipment], or J2209 [HFC-134a (R-134a) recy-
cling equipment], If accidental system discharge occurs, ventilate work area before resuming
service. Additional health and safety information may be obtained from refrigerant and oil manufac-
turers.
